ALLEN BRADLEY INPUT OUTPUT MODULE 1794-OB8EP Specification

  • Rated Current
  • 4A per module max
  • Output Current
  • 500 mA per channel (max)
  • Cooling Method
  • Natural convection
  • Operating Temperature
  • -20C to +55C
  • Connector Type
  • Removable Terminal Block
  • Current Range
  • 8-point, sourcing
  • Application
  • Industrial Automation
  • Features
  • Electronic protection, field-side diagnostics, removable terminal block
  • Output Type
  • Digital Output
  • Power Supply
  • 10-31.2V DC
  • Working Temperature
  • -20C to +55C
  • Product Type
  • Input Output Module
  • Output Frequency
  • DC
  • Voltage Protection
  • Short-circuit and overload protection
  • Material
  • Plastic
  • Storage Temperature
  • -40C to +85C
  • Weight
  • Approx. 120 g
  • Channels
  • 8 (Sourcing Outputs)
  • Mounting Type
  • DIN Rail Mount
  • Status Indicators
  • Yes (per channel)
  • Response Time
  • 0.5 ms On/Off
  • Output Voltage Range
  • 10-31.2V DC
  • Isolation Voltage
  • 50V (continuous), Basic Insulation
  • Module Series
  • 1794 Series
  • Module Type
  • Flex I/O

FAQs of ALLEN BRADLEY INPUT OUTPUT MODULE 1794-OB8EP:


Q: How can I benefit from using the ALLEN BRADLEY 1794-OB8EP module in industrial automation?

A: The module enhances process control with fast response, reliable output protection, and channel-specific diagnostics, ensuring efficient and secure operation in complex environments.

Q: What types of outputs does the 1794-OB8EP support?

A: This module features eight sourcing digital outputs, compatible with 10-31.2V DC voltage ranges, each supporting up to 500mA current per channel.

Q: Where is the ideal environment to install the 1794-OB8EP module?

A: It is suited for industrial applications, thanks to its DIN rail mounting, natural convection cooling, and robust operating temperature range between -20C to +55C.

Q: How does short-circuit and overload protection work in this module?

A: The modules advanced electronic protection system automatically detects and safeguards against electrical faults, preserving both the module and connected equipment.
